It is not yet entirely clear who is responsible for the attack.
Israeli officials deny targeting the hospital and say they believe the blast was caused by a rocket from Hamas or Islamic Jihad that fell short and struck the site.
The Palestinian Islamic Jihad has also denied responsibility.
The Israeli military reportedly said an initial investigation suggested the explosion was caused by a failed Hamas rocket launch, but the scale of the blast appears to be outside the militant group’s capabilities.
The incident is already the biggest single loss of life in Gaza in the five wars between Hamas and Israel since the militants took over the strip in 2007.
